For those living with sleep apnea, Continuous Positive Airway Pressure (CPAP) therapy is a vital part of maintaining good health and getting a restful night’s sleep. However, maintaining this therapy while traveling can be challenging without the right equipment. Portable CPAP machines have become a game-changer, offering the same therapeutic benefits as traditional devices but in a compact, travel-friendly package.

Why Choose a Portable CPAP Machine?

Convenience for Travelers

Traveling, whether for work or leisure, should not disrupt your CPAP therapy. Portable CPAP machines are designed to provide consistent therapy, even when you're far from home. These compact devices are lightweight and easy to pack, ensuring that you can continue your treatment regimen without hassle. They are particularly beneficial for frequent travelers, as they reduce the burden of carrying a bulky machine. With a portable CPAP machine, you can maintain your routine and enjoy peace of mind knowing that your therapy is uninterrupted, no matter where your journey takes you.

Compliance and Flexibility

Compliance with CPAP therapy is crucial for managing sleep apnea effectively. Portable CPAP machines offer a flexible solution, allowing you to adhere to your therapy plan even in varied travel situations, such as on airplanes, in hotels, or on road trips. These machines are designed to be user-friendly and adaptable, with features that make them suitable for different environments. By ensuring that your CPAP therapy is always within reach, these portable devices help you stay on track with your treatment, reducing the risk of complications associated with non-compliance.

Top Portable CPAP Machines on the Market

1. Transcend Micro Auto Travel CPAP Machine

The Transcend Micro is currently the smallest and lightest CPAP machine on the market, making it an excellent choice for travelers who prioritize portability. Weighing less than half a pound and easily fitting in the palm of your hand, the Transcend Micro is designed to go anywhere you do. Despite its small size, this machine is packed with features that make it a powerful tool for managing sleep apnea on the go.

The Transcend Micro offers auto-adjusting pressure settings, which means it can automatically adapt to your breathing patterns throughout the night. This feature is particularly useful for those who experience varying levels of apnea during different stages of sleep. Additionally, the machine operates quietly, ensuring that both you and your travel companions can sleep soundly without disturbance.

One of the standout features of the Transcend Micro is its USB charging capability. This makes it easy to charge the machine using a power bank or your car’s USB port, adding to its convenience for travel. It’s also FAA-approved for in-flight use, which means you can use it on airplanes without any issues. However, it's worth noting that the battery life is limited compared to larger models, so you may need to plan for recharging during longer trips. While it might not have all the advanced features of full-sized CPAP machines, the Transcend Micro’s portability and ease of use make it a top contender for travelers.

2. ResMed AirMini AutoSet Travel CPAP Machine

The ResMed AirMini is a leader in the portable CPAP market, known for its advanced features and reliable performance. This compact machine is designed to provide the same high-quality therapy as ResMed’s full-sized models, but in a much smaller package. The AirMini’s AutoSet technology automatically adjusts pressure levels to suit your needs, ensuring that you receive optimal therapy throughout the night.

One of the most innovative features of the AirMini is its HumidX waterless humidification system. Traditional CPAP machines require water-based humidifiers to prevent dryness and irritation during therapy. However, the AirMini’s HumidX system uses small, disposable cartridges to provide humidification without the need for water, making it easier to use on the go. This is especially useful for travelers who may not always have easy access to clean water.

The AirMini also offers Bluetooth connectivity, allowing you to track your sleep data and adjust settings via the ResMed app. This feature gives you greater control over your therapy and helps you monitor your progress, even while traveling. However, one potential drawback is that the AirMini is only compatible with specific ResMed masks, so you may need to purchase a new mask if your current one is not supported. Additionally, the AirMini comes with a higher price tag compared to some other portable models, which may be a consideration for budget-conscious travelers. Despite these factors, the AirMini’s advanced features and compact design make it an excellent choice for those who want top-tier therapy in a portable form.

3. Luna Travel PAP

The Luna Travel PAP is a robust and reliable option for sleep apnea patients who need effective therapy while on the go. This travel-friendly CPAP machine is compact and lightweight, making it ideal for frequent travelers. Despite its small size, the Luna Travel PAP does not compromise on performance, delivering consistent and precise pressure levels to ensure you receive the same quality of treatment as you would with a full-sized CPAP machine.

One of the standout features of the Luna Travel PAP is its integrated humidifier, which helps prevent dryness and irritation by adding moisture to the air you breathe during therapy. This is particularly beneficial for users who experience discomfort due to dry air, making the Luna Travel PAP an excellent choice for maintaining comfort throughout the night.

Additionally, the machine’s user-friendly interface and easy-to-read display make it simple to adjust settings and monitor your therapy. The Luna Travel PAP also boasts a quiet operation, ensuring that you and your bed partner can enjoy a peaceful night’s sleep without disruption. With its robust design and advanced features, the Luna Travel PAP is a strong contender for anyone in need of a portable CPAP solution.

How to Choose the Right Portable CPAP Machine for You

Consider Your Travel Needs

When choosing a portable CPAP machine, it’s important to consider how often and in what circumstances you’ll be using it. For frequent travelers, a machine that is lightweight and easy to pack is essential. If you often travel by air, look for a machine that is FAA-approved for in-flight use, like the Transcend Micro. For those who take long road trips or camping excursions, a machine with a long-lasting battery, such as the DreamStation Go, may be more suitable.

Features to Look For

Different portable CPAP machines come with various features, so it’s important to choose one that meets your specific needs. Auto-adjusting pressure settings are a valuable feature, as they ensure that you receive the correct level of therapy throughout the night. Humidification is another important consideration; while traditional water-based humidifiers can be cumbersome, options like the ResMed AirMini’s HumidX system offer waterless humidification, making them more convenient for travel.

Additionally, consider the machine’s compatibility with your current CPAP mask. As we’ve mentioned, some portable machines, like the AirMini, are only compatible with specific masks, so you may need to invest in a new mask if your existing one is not supported. Ease of use is another important factor; look for machines with user-friendly interfaces and simple controls, especially if you’re new to CPAP therapy.

Budget Considerations

Portable CPAP machines vary in price, with more advanced models typically costing more. While it’s important to find a machine that fits your budget, it’s equally important to ensure that the machine you choose provides the necessary therapeutic benefits. Cheaper models may lack certain features, such as auto-adjusting pressure or humidification, which could impact the effectiveness of your therapy. On the other hand, investing in a higher-end machine with the features you need can be a worthwhile expense, particularly if you travel frequently and rely on your CPAP machine to maintain your health and well-being.

FAQs

Do I need a prescription for a travel CPAP?
Yes, a prescription is required to purchase a travel CPAP machine. This is because CPAP machines are classified as medical devices, and a healthcare provider needs to determine the appropriate settings and specifications based on your specific needs. It’s important to consult with your doctor before purchasing any CPAP machine, whether it’s for home use or travel.

Will insurance pay for a travel CPAP?
Insurance coverage for a travel CPAP machine varies depending on your provider and plan. Some insurance companies may cover the cost of a travel CPAP as part of your durable medical equipment benefits, but others may not. It’s advisable to check with your insurance provider to understand what is covered under your plan and if a travel CPAP machine qualifies.

What machine can I use instead of a CPAP?
For individuals who cannot tolerate CPAP therapy, there are alternative treatments available. Some of these include BiPAP (Bilevel Positive Airway Pressure) machines, which provide different pressure levels for inhalation and exhalation, and APAP (Automatic Positive Airway Pressure) machines, which automatically adjust pressure throughout the night. Other options include oral appliances, positional therapy, or in severe cases, surgery. It’s important to consult with your doctor to determine the best alternative treatment for your sleep apnea.

Can a person just buy a CPAP machine?
No, you cannot simply buy a CPAP machine without a prescription. Since CPAP machines are regulated medical devices, a healthcare provider must prescribe one based on your diagnosis and specific treatment needs. The prescription ensures that the machine is properly configured to provide effective therapy for your sleep apnea.

Are portable CPAP machines as effective as regular ones?
Yes, portable CPAP machines are designed to provide the same therapeutic benefits as standard-sized CPAP machines. They deliver consistent airflow and maintain the prescribed pressure settings required for effective sleep apnea therapy. However, some portable models may have fewer advanced features or shorter battery life compared to full-sized machines. It’s important to choose a portable CPAP that meets your specific needs and provides the necessary treatment effectiveness.

Can I use a portable CPAP machine as my primary device?
Yes, you can use a portable CPAP machine as your primary device, especially if you travel frequently or have limited space at home. Many portable CPAP machines are designed to offer the same level of therapy as standard machines, making them suitable for regular use. However, some users may prefer a full-sized machine for everyday use due to additional features, such as more advanced humidification options. It’s a good idea to consult with your healthcare provider to determine whether a portable CPAP machine can meet your long-term therapy needs.

How do I clean and maintain a portable CPAP machine?
Maintaining a portable CPAP machine is similar to maintaining a full-sized one. You should regularly clean the mask, tubing, and water chamber (if applicable) using mild soap and water. Some portable CPAP machines are compatible with automated cleaning devices like CPAP sanitizers. It’s also important to replace filters, mask cushions, and other parts as recommended by the manufacturer. Regular maintenance ensures that your CPAP machine functions properly and provides effective therapy.
